In the eight-step training model, what is Step 1?

Explanation:
The key idea here is starting with understanding the assignment. In the eight-step training model, you begin by receiving the mission to clearly grasp what you are training for—the task, its purpose, the desired end state, and any constraints from higher command. This initial clarity sets the direction for every later step, ensuring your planning, resource identification, briefs, and execution all align with the actual objective. If you jump straight into planning or briefing without this understanding, you risk pursuing the wrong goals or missing critical requirements. Once the mission is received, you move on to planning the training and coordinating the necessary resources, then conducting briefings and executing the plan.
